Restoration of a Vintage Longines Conquest Automatic – Caliber 19ASD

This vintage Longines Conquest Automatic, powered by the Longines caliber 19ASD, was brought to our watchmaking workshop in Geneva for a complete mechanical restoration.

The watch showed several issues related to its age and repair history: a broken winding stem, a non-functional crown, a cracked crystal, as well as various signs of wear and mechanical issues within the movement.

The goal of the restoration was to restore reliable operation while preserving as many original components as possible and maintaining the character of this vintage Longines.

Initial Diagnosis

Before any work was performed, the watch underwent a complete diagnostic inspection.

Movement and Gear Train

Inspection of the Longines caliber 19ASD revealed several areas requiring attention:

  • dried lubricants due to age;
  • excessive play within the gear train;
  • lateral play at the seconds wheel pivot;
  • signs of wear on several pivots;
  • several mechanical adjustments required within the movement.

These issues can directly affect power transmission and the overall stability and performance of the movement.

Regulating Organ and Escapement

The inspection also revealed several issues requiring the watchmaker’s attention within the regulating organ and escapement.

The hairspring required correction, the beat needed adjustment, and additional work was necessary within the escapement and regulating system.

On a vintage movement such as the Longines caliber 19ASD, these issues must be addressed before the watch can be properly regulated.

Winding Stem and Crown

The winding stem was broken.

Closer inspection showed that it had previously been repaired using a stem extension, which had also broken.

A replacement stem compatible with the Longines caliber 19ASD therefore had to be sourced. The crown was also no longer functional and required replacement to restore proper winding and time-setting operation.

Crystal

The acrylic crystal had a small crack along one side.
Replacement was necessary to properly protect the dial and hands while maintaining an appearance consistent with the vintage character of the watch.

Water Resistance

The inspection also determined that water resistance could not be guaranteed.
The condition of the case-back gasket seating surface, together with the age and condition of other case components, prevented reliable water resistance from being restored.
With a vintage watch, it is important to distinguish between restoring the mechanical movement and restoring the original water-resistance specifications.

Work Performed

Following the diagnosis, the necessary work was carried out to restore the proper operation of this Longines Conquest Automatic.

Complete overhaul of the automatic mechanical movement
✓ Correction of identified wear and excessive play
✓ Work on the regulating organ and escapement
✓ Restoration of the winding and time-setting system
✓ Replacement of the winding stem
✓ Replacement of the crown
✓ Replacement of the acrylic crystal
✓ Movement lubrication
✓ Regulation and rate testing
✓ Final functional checks

The objective was to preserve as many existing components as possible while restoring reliable performance appropriate for the age of the watch.

Results After Restoration

Following the restoration, this Longines Conquest Automatic regained stable mechanical operation.

The winding and time-setting system was restored, the mechanical issues identified during the initial diagnosis were corrected, and the movement was regulated and tested.

The new crystal once again provides proper protection for the dial while preserving the vintage appearance of the watch.

Due to the condition of the case, however, the watch should still be considered non-water-resistant and worn accordingly.

What May Have Caused These Issues?

In the case of this Longines Conquest, several factors may have contributed to the problems identified during the inspection.

Age of the watch
Over time, lubricants deteriorate and dry out, while mechanical components gradually develop wear and excessive play.

Natural movement wear
Pivots, wheels, and other contact points are continuously subjected to friction whenever the watch is running.

Previous repairs
The winding stem, for example, had previously been repaired using an extension. With a vintage watch, work performed over several decades often becomes an important part of the diagnostic process.

Aging of the case and external components
The crystal, crown, gaskets, and their contact surfaces also deteriorate over time, which can eventually make reliable water resistance impossible to guarantee.

Our Recommendations for a Vintage Longines

To help preserve a vintage mechanical watch such as this Longines Conquest:

  • avoid all contact with water when water resistance cannot be guaranteed;
  • never force the crown if winding or setting the time becomes difficult;
  • have the watch inspected if you notice a significant change in accuracy or power reserve;
  • schedule periodic maintenance to prevent dried lubricants and progressive wear from causing further damage to the movement.

Having a watch inspected before problems become severe often makes it possible to preserve more of its original components.
